原文:vs2017 如何定位C++内存泄漏

定位内存泄漏是C 的一个棘手问题,可行的方法之一如下: 在debug模式下,在输出中可以看到如下信息: 请注意大括号 中的内容,此处是 ,这就是程序可能内存泄露的地方。 将上面注释的代码加入,并将大括号中的数字填入,就可以让程序停在内存泄漏的地方。 如下,这里我让程序停在 处: 参考:https: www.cnblogs.com luruiyuan p .html ...

2018-02-22 22:45 0 2516 推荐指数:

查看详情

vs 2017/2015/2013 如何定位C++内存泄漏

定位内存泄漏C++的一个大问题 我们可以通过如下方式进行定位: 在 debug 模式下,可以看到如下信息: 此时我们注意大括号的内容,这就是可以我们的程序内存泄漏的地方。 将上面注释掉的代码加入,并将大括号的数字填入,就可以让程序停在内存泄漏的地方 ...

Mon May 29 05:13:00 CST 2017 0 5872
VS2017设置C++标准

Visual Studio 2017 版本15.3: /std:c++14 和 /std:c++latest:通过这些编译器开关可选择在项目中加入特定版本的 ISO C++ 编程语言。 大多数新的草案标准功能由 /std:c++latest 开关保护。 通过 /std ...

Wed Jun 27 19:39:00 CST 2018 0 11721
VS2017安装C++

安装:https://www.zhihu.com/question/65989308 多行注释:先CTRL+K,然后CTRL+C 取消注释: 先CTRL+K,然后CTRL+U 字体:工具--->选项-->字体和颜色 番茄助手安装 ...

Sat Aug 01 00:43:00 CST 2020 0 1028
C++检测和定位内存泄漏

1、首先需要宏定义一下new运算符 解释: new(a, b, c) T; 会被解释成一个函数调用operator new(sizeof(T), a, b, c)。这是C++就有的行为 operator new, operator new[],user-defined ...

Tue Sep 28 23:09:00 CST 2021 0 112
VS2017中配置VLD(Visual Leak Detector)内存泄漏检测工具

首先在官方下载VLD 下载地址: 此版本为V2.5.1,为最后发布版本,下载后安装。加入你的安装路径为:VLD_Path,后面会用到。 打开VS2017,创建一个工程,在资源管理器中的项目右键属性, 然后找到VC++目录,在包含目录中添加:VLD_PATH\include ...

Fri Feb 22 05:04:00 CST 2019 0 3644
VS2017 C/C++输入密码显示*星号

VS2017 C/C++输入密码显示*星号 _getch()函数使用时遇到的坑 参考: https://blog.csdn.net/guin_guo/article/details/46237905 想实现输入密码不回显的功能,找到了上面一篇文章。上面那篇文章中 ...

Tue Apr 09 02:18:00 CST 2019 0 789
VS2017编写c/c++汇编函数并调用

首先在VS里面创建个空项目,然后添加汇编文件 .asm, 右键asm文件属性 --- 常规,改成下图的设置 , 从生成中排除改为否, 项类型改为自定义生成工具 然后点确定。 再次右键asm文件属性, 配置属性 ---自定义生成工具 --- 常规 :在命令行中写入 ...

Wed Feb 26 06:44:00 CST 2020 0 1086
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M